Openvpn mssfix — полное понимание этого понятия

OpenVPN — это одна из самых популярных и надежных программных реализаций Virtual Private Network (VPN). Она позволяет пользователям устанавливать безопасное и зашифрованное соединение между своим устройством и удаленной сетью. Одной из важных возможностей OpenVPN является настройка mssfix.

MSS (Maximum Segment Size) определяет максимальный размер сегмента данных в TCP-пакете. Иногда возникают проблемы передачи данных через VPN, и это может быть связано с фрагментацией TCP-пакетов. Когда пакеты фрагментируются, это приводит к потерям данных и замедлению скорости передачи.

Чтобы решить эту проблему, OpenVPN предлагает параметр mssfix. При его использовании OpenVPN автоматически настроит максимальный размер сегмента данных для установленного соединения, чтобы избежать фрагментации пакетов.

Настройка mssfix очень полезна, особенно при использовании VPN для передачи потокового видео, голосовых и видео-связей или при работе со службами, требующими высокой скорости передачи данных.

Итак, если вы столкнулись с проблемами при передаче данных через OpenVPN, особенно с потерями пакетов и замедлением скорости, попробуйте использовать параметр mssfix для решения этих проблем и обеспечения более стабильного и эффективного соединения.

Что такое OpenVPN mssfix и зачем он нужен?

Итак, зачем нужно использовать OpenVPN mssfix? Во-первых, это позволяет избежать проблем с фрагментацией данных. Когда данные передаются через VPN-туннель, они могут быть разделены на несколько маленьких фрагментов. Если размер TCP-сегмента превышает максимально допустимый по умолчанию размер пакета между двумя узлами, они могут быть разделены на фрагменты, что замедлит и усложнит процесс передачи данных.

Вторая причина использования OpenVPN mssfix заключается в обеспечении обратной совместимости с различными типами сетей и устройств. Разные сети и устройства могут иметь различные ограничения на размер данных, которые они могут обработать или передать. Mssfix позволяет настраивать размер TCP-сегмента данных, чтобы обеспечить совместимость с конкретной сетью или устройством. Это может быть полезно, например, при подключении к сетям с небольшим MTU (Maximum Transmission Unit).

Читайте также:  Windows 10 20h2 19042 631

В итоге, использование OpenVPN mssfix позволяет улучшить производительность и надежность VPN-соединения. Он обеспечивает оптимальную передачу данных через туннель и упрощает настройку совместимости с разными типами сетей и устройств. Поэтому, при настройке OpenVPN соединения, необходимо учитывать значение mssfix для достижения наилучших результатов.

Принцип работы OpenVPN mssfix

Когда в сети VPN передается пакет, он проверяется на размер. Если размер пакета превышает установленное значение параметра mssfix, то пакет будет разделен на несколько фрагментов меньшего размера. Это может происходить, когда сеть VPN имеет ограничения на размер пакетов, например, из-за ограниченной пропускной способности или настройки маршрутизаторов.

Параметр mssfix позволяет определить наибольший размер пакета, который будет передан в сети VPN без фрагментации. Если какой-либо пакет превышает этот размер, то OpenVPN автоматически разделит его на меньшие фрагменты. Это позволяет избежать потери данных и снижает вероятность возникновения проблем с передачей данных в сети VPN.

Важно отметить, что значение параметра mssfix должно быть корректно настроено в соответствии с требованиями сети VPN. Установка слишком низкого значения может привести к возникновению проблем с передачей данных, а установка слишком высокого значения может привести к фрагментации пакетов. Настройка mssfix должна быть осуществлена с учетом конфигурации сети и наилучших практик для обеспечения эффективной передачи данных в сети VPN.

Какие проблемы решает OpenVPN mssfix?

Одна из основных проблем, которую решает OpenVPN mssfix, связана с фрагментацией пакетов данных. Фрагментация происходит, когда размер пакета превышает максимально допустимый размер, установленный на маршрутизаторах или других сетевых устройствах на пути передачи данных. Это может привести к потере или повторной передаче пакетов, что снижает скорость и надежность соединения. OpenVPN mssfix автоматически оптимизирует размер пакетов данных, чтобы сохранить их в пределах максимально допустимого размера и избежать фрагментации.

Еще одна проблема, которую решает OpenVPN mssfix, связана с MTU (Maximum Transmission Unit) — максимальным размером пакета данных, который может быть передан по сети без фрагментации. Если размер пакета превышает MTU сети, то данные могут быть разделены на более маленькие части и переданы отдельными пакетами, что также может привести к потере или повторной передаче данных. OpenVPN mssfix позволяет оптимизировать размер пакетов таким образом, чтобы они не превышали MTU сети и могли быть переданы без фрагментации.

Читайте также:  Быстрые клавиши - автозамена в Word

В целом, использование OpenVPN mssfix помогает улучшить производительность, стабильность и надежность VPN-соединений, позволяя избежать проблем, связанных с фрагментацией пакетов данных и превышением MTU сети. Эта настройка особенно полезна при передаче больших объемов данных или при работе с медленными или нестабильными сетевыми соединениями.

Настройка OpenVPN mssfix

MSS (Maximum Segment Size) – это параметр, который определяет максимально возможный размер сегмента данных TCP/IP, передаваемого через сеть. Изменение этого параметра может быть полезно, когда возникают проблемы с передачей данных при использовании OpenVPN.

Настройка mssfix позволяет определить максимальный размер сегмента данных, который будет передаваться через соединение OpenVPN. Задавая оптимальное значение mssfix, можно улучшить производительность соединения, устранить фрагментацию пакетов и снизить задержку при передаче данных.

Для настройки mssfix вам необходимо изменить файл конфигурации OpenVPN. В этом файле вы найдете опции, которые влияют на параметры сетевых соединений. Чтобы установить значение mssfix, добавьте в файл следующую строку:

mssfix <значение>

Где <значение> представляет собой числовое значение, указывающее максимальный размер сегмента данных.

После внесения изменений сохраните и закройте файл конфигурации OpenVPN. Перезапустите сервис OpenVPN для применения настроек. Теперь ваше соединение OpenVPN будет оптимизировано с учетом заданного значения mssfix.

Важно помнить, что при настройке mssfix следует учитывать особенности вашей сети и внешних условий. Рекомендуется провести тестирование после внесения изменений, чтобы убедиться, что новые настройки работают оптимально.

Плюсы и минусы использования OpenVPN mssfix

Плюсы:

  • Увеличение производительности: OpenVPN mssfix позволяет оптимизировать передачу пакетов данных, особенно при работе с большими файлами или при использовании приложений, требующих высокой скорости передачи данных. Эта опция позволяет установить оптимальный размер пакета, что уменьшает количество фрагментированных и повторно отправленных пакетов.
  • Улучшенная безопасность: OpenVPN mssfix распределяет и регулирует размер TCP-пакетов, что помогает предотвратить обнаружение или блокирование VPN-трафика провайдерами или противниками.
  • Снижение задержки: Использование OpenVPN mssfix может существенно сократить задержку в передаче данных. Это особенно важно при работе с интерактивными приложениями или потоковым видео, где даже небольшая задержка может повлиять на качество воспроизведения.
Читайте также:  Check all services running windows

Минусы:

  • Настройка: Правильная настройка OpenVPN mssfix может быть сложной задачей, особенно для непрофессиональных пользователей. Неправильная настройка может привести к снижению производительности или даже отказу в работе VPN-соединения.
  • Возможные проблемы: Использование OpenVPN mssfix может вызвать некоторые проблемы совместимости с некоторыми приложениями или операционными системами. Некоторые приложения или устройства могут не поддерживать опцию mssfix, что может вызвать проблемы при передаче данных.
  • Некоторая потеря производительности: Малая потеря производительности может быть связана с использованием OpenVPN mssfix, так как размер пакетов будет слегка увеличен из-за добавления дополнительных заголовков для регулирования размера пакетов.

Альтернативы OpenVPN mssfix: другие методы оптимизации MTU

Одним из методов оптимизации MTU в OpenVPN является использование параметра mssfix, который позволяет установить максимальное значение MTU для передачи данных. Однако, есть и другие альтернативные методы, которые также помогают улучшить производительность соединения.

1. Fragment

Один из способов решить проблему фрагментации пакетов — это использование опции Fragment в конфигурационном файле OpenVPN. Эта опция позволяет разбивать пакеты на более мелкие фрагменты, что снижает возможность потери данных и повышает производительность. Однако, следует учитывать, что использование Fragment может привести к некоторому увеличению нагрузки на процессор.

2. TCP-nodelay

Еще одним методом оптимизации MTU является использование опции TCP-nodelay. Эта опция позволяет отключить задержку перед отправкой данных через TCP-соединение. При использовании TCP-nodelay данные отправляются в сжатых пакетах, что повышает скорость передачи данных и увеличивает производительность соединения.

3. Вручную настройте MTU

Если ни один из вышеперечисленных методов не помогает в решении проблемы фрагментации пакетов, можно попробовать изменить MTU вручную. Для этого необходимо определить оптимальное значение MTU для вашей сети и внести изменения в конфигурационный файл OpenVPN.

В итоге, OpenVPN mssfix — это не единственный способ оптимизации MTU для соединения через OpenVPN. Существуют и другие методы, такие как использование опции Fragment и TCP-nodelay, а также настройка MTU вручную. Выбор метода зависит от вашей сетевой среды и требований к производительности соединения.

Оцените статью